《剖析关系型数据库的优势与局限》
在当今的数据管理领域,关系型数据库长期以来占据着重要的地位,它以其独特的设计理念和技术特点,为众多企业和组织提供了可靠的数据存储和管理解决方案,如同任何技术一样,关系型数据库也并非完美无缺,存在着一定的局限性。
关系型数据库的优势十分显著。
它具有高度的结构化,数据被组织成严格定义的表,表之间通过关联键建立起清晰的关系,这使得数据的一致性和完整性得到了有力保障,无论是复杂的业务逻辑还是日常的数据查询操作,都能在这种结构化的环境中高效进行,减少了数据混乱和错误的可能性。
关系型数据库支持强大的查询语言,如 SQL(Structured Query Language,结构化查询语言),通过灵活运用各种查询语句,用户可以快速、准确地从大量数据中检索出所需信息,其丰富的功能,如连接、聚合、子查询等,使得复杂的数据查询变得轻而易举,为数据分析和决策提供了有力支持。
关系型数据库在数据的一致性和事务处理方面表现出色,事务确保了一组操作要么全部成功执行,要么全部不执行,保证了数据的准确性和可靠性,这对于涉及资金交易、订单处理等关键业务场景至关重要。
关系型数据库经过多年的发展和实践,拥有成熟的技术体系和广泛的社区支持,这意味着在遇到问题时,可以很容易地找到解决方案和技术资源,降低了技术风险和维护成本。
关系型数据库也面临着一些挑战。
随着数据量的不断增长和业务需求的日益复杂,关系型数据库在处理大规模数据和高并发访问时可能会遇到性能瓶颈,特别是在面对非结构化数据和实时数据分析需求时,其灵活性和扩展性相对不足。
关系型数据库的设计和维护相对复杂,需要对数据结构进行精心规划和设计,以确保其合理性和高效性,对数据库的调整和优化也需要一定的技术经验和专业知识。
为了应对这些挑战,数据库领域也在不断发展和创新,一些新型的数据库技术,如分布式数据库、NoSQL 数据库等,逐渐崭露头角,为解决关系型数据库的局限性提供了新的思路和方法。
关系型数据库在数据管理领域具有不可替代的地位,其优势使其在许多传统的业务场景中依然表现出色,但同时,我们也不能忽视其局限性,需要根据实际业务需求和数据特点,合理选择和运用数据库技术,以实现最佳的数据管理效果,在未来,随着技术的不断进步,关系型数据库也将不断演进和完善,继续为数据管理和应用开发提供坚实的基础。
评论列表